HIP 26676
HIP 26676 is a star located in the constellation Orion.
Located approximately 213.3 light-years from Earth, HIP 26676 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.
At an apparent magnitude of +10.20, HIP 26676 is a faint star that requires a telescope to observe. It is invisible to the naked eye and too dim for most binoculars. Observers will note its yellow-white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.650.
